Definition of ESCARGOT

escargot

Plural: escargots

Noun

  • An edible snail, typically served as an appetizer.
  • edible terrestrial snail usually served in the shell with a sauce of melted butter and garlic
  • A dish, commonly associated with French cuisine, consisting of edible snails.
  • A snail (often Helix pomatia) used in preparation of that dish.
